Today George Burruss and I headed up to the Blue-ridge Parkway to do a
little birding around the entrances to Warbler road and Petites Gap. We had 3
Black-throated Green Warblers at Petites, and several Ovenbirds,
Black-and-white, Black-throated Green, and 1 Black-throated Blue warbler at
Warbler Road. We also had Yellow-rumped Warblers, a Pine Warbler, and a few
Louisiana Waterthrushes at the James River Gap. In Lynchburg there were 2
Palm Warblers and a Common Yellowthroat at College Lake, and Yellow-throated
Warblers and Prothonotary Warblers were seen at Percival’s Island. Other
highlights included a Broad-winged Hawk, Blue-headed Vireo, and Hooded
Merganser.
